Today most zircon is produced from mining sediments from beach or alluvial deposits Zircon is often a coproduct at mining or processing operations where ilmenite and rutile are being mined for their titanium content Zircon is extracted by dry mining methods if the deposit is shallow or contains harder materials

More DetailZirconia zirconium chemicals and zirconium metal Summary Zircon is the zircon silicate mineral ZrSiO 4 found with titanium minerals notably ilmenite Zircon is also found naturally as baddeleyite notably in South Africa It is separated by a wetgravity technique followed by a dryseparation magnetic and electrostatic process

More DetailIlmenite rutile and zircon are the three heavy minerals mined from the sand mines at Sibelco’s North Stradbroke Island Operation in Queensland Australia The heavy minerals extracted account for 1 of the total sand The remaining 99 is used in post mining rehabilitation

More DetailA significant portion of mineral sands EDR is in areas quarantined from mining because they are largely incorporated in national parks and other areas with restricted access to mining Geoscience Australia estimates that around 16 of ilmenite 14 of rutile and 14 of zircon EDR is unavailable for mining
More DetailZircon source and significance The source of these zircons is attributed to the largely igneous second phase of the Lachlan Orogen which produced granitoids over the period 440–360 Ma Sircombe 1999 Zircons of this age dominate in the WIM 150 heavy mineral deposit and were sourced from southern central Victoria
